Covers a method of preparing polyether polyols useful in making a polyisocyanurate polymer by oxyalkylating an alcohol by the catalytic addition of an alkylene oxide to said alcohol in presence of a catalyst selected from the group consisting of carbamate salts, aminophenols, hexahydro-s-triazines and tetrahydrooxadiazines.

A polyamide co-polymer polyol made by the reaction of a dicarboxylic acid diester with a diamine in the presence of a polyether polyol is described. The nylon formed should be present in the polyol in an amount of from 1 to 30 wt. %. The polyether polyol may have a molecular weight of about 2,000 to 8,000. This polyamide co-polymer polyol may be used in the manufacture of elastomers and flexible polyurethane foams which are characterized by good load bearing properties.

Mixtures of aromatic polyols containing amide and ester functionalities suitable for use in rigid foams prepared by reacting a phthalic acid residue with an amino alcohol and subsequent alkoxylation are described. These novel polyols may be blended with conventional polyols to yield rigid foams with better flammability resistance as compared with foams made from conventional polyols alone.

The modification of polyether polyols by their reaction with epoxy resin and alkylene oxides is described. The modified polyols of 2000 to 7000 molecular weight produce flexible polyurethane foams that have higher load bearing properties than foams made with nonmodified polyols. The ability of a modified polyol to make a higher load bearing foam is related to the position in the polyol chain the epoxy resin is added.

A process for preparing a polyurea reaction injection molded (RIM) elastomer is described. A hindered polyetherpolyamine is first obtained by reacting a polyol having two or more hydroxyl groups with an effective amount of long chain alkyl epoxide to give an at least partially hindered intermediate having hydroxyl terminations; and then aminating at least one of the hydroxyl terminations on the intermediate to primary amine groups to give an at least partially hindered polyetherpolyamine. The hindered polyetherpolyamine is then reacted with a polyisocyanate in the optional presence of a catalyst to give a polyurea RIM elastomer. The long chain alkyl group provides steric hindrance to the primary aliphatic amine group, which slows down the reactivity of the amine. The slower reactivity of the amine group is useful in RIM and RRIM compositions since it allows for longer shot or flow times, which in turn permit larger parts to be made from existing equipment.

N-butylmorpholine and N,N'-dimethylpiperazine may be used together as a catalyst system in an activator solution to give finer, more uniform cells to polyester-based polyurethane foams if a solvent is employed. It was surprisingly discovered that the components must be used together as a catalyst-solvent system to avoid the disadvantages observed when one of the components is changed or left out. For example, if the solvent were not present in the activator solution in proportions of at least 1 wt. %, the activator solution would not be homogeneous.

Covers N-(3-dimethylaminopropyl)-N'-(3-morpholino-propyl)urea. Also covers a method of producing a polyurethane by utilizing said above compound as a catalyst in reacting an organic polyisocyanate with an organic polyester polyol or polyether polyol in the presence of said catalyst.
